Innerspring Mattresses Analysis
Innerspring mattresses, celebrated for their timeless build, employ a coil system to provide support and comfort. These mattresses deliver excellent breathability because of their open structure, making them a favored choice for people who often sleep hot. They commonly come in different firmness levels, suited to various sleep preferences. Yet, the coil systems can cause motion transfer, potentially distressing a partner's rest. Moreover, though potentially more affordable than some other types, innerspring mattresses may wear down quicker, causing sagging over time. Ultimately, they offer a reliable option for those desiring a traditional feel and solid support, but buyers should consider their personal needs and preferences before deciding.
Memory Foam Advantages
Memory foam mattresses provide a unique blend of support and comfort that attracts many sleepers. Their capacity to contour to the body's shape delivers superior pressure relief, making them particularly advantageous for those with pain material in joints or discomfort. Additionally, memory foam tends to reduce motion, which is ideal for pairs, as it reduces interruptions caused by motion. These mattresses are also recognized for their longevity, often retaining their shape and supportive qualities as time passes. However, some people may find them too warm due to heat retention, and the starting odor from manufacturing can be off-putting. Overall, memory foam mattresses provide a compelling option for people pursuing a balance of comfort and support in their sleeping space.
Latex Mattress Advantages
Latex mattresses represent a attractive choice to memory foam, supplying a varied set of perks for those in want of a robust sleep surface. One major benefit is their inherent resilience, which supplies first-rate support and pressure relief without the sink-in feel often tied to memory foam. Additionally, latex mattresses are prized for their durability, often enduring further than traditional foam options. They also provide superior temperature regulation due to their open-cell structure, allowing improved airflow and a cooler sleeping environment. Furthermore, many latex mattresses are made from green materials, drawing appeal from environmentally conscious consumers. Overall, those desiring a fusion of comfort, support, and environmental responsibility may recognize latex mattresses to be an ideal choice.
Methods to Find the Most Suitable Mattress Firmness for Your Body
What method should a person take to discover the ideal mattress feel for a restful night's sleep? The approach commences by evaluating individual preferences and sleep styles. Side sleepers typically enjoy benefits from a gentler mattress, which provides support the shoulders and hips, while back and stomach sleepers often need a stiffer surface for proper spinal alignment.
Subsequently, physical weight serves as an important role; individuals weighing less may consider softer mattresses more comfortable, while heavier people often select firmer alternatives to prevent settling too far.
Moreover, testing mattresses in-store or utilizing online sleep quizzes can provide worthwhile insights. A trial period is indispensable, letting individuals to assess comfort over several nights.
Ultimately, finding the perfect mattress firmness is a personal process, requiring focus to coziness, support, and specific sleep needs. Spending time in this decision can greatly enhance overall sleep standards, leading to superior rest and improved well-being.

Test Various Positions
Testing different sleeping positions on a mattress is crucial for determining its suitability for personal requirements. When evaluating a mattress, people should try lying on their back, side, and stomach to assess comfort and support across these positions. Each position engages different body parts, influencing how well the mattress conforms and alleviates pressure points. While lying on the back, attention should be paid to lumbar support, guaranteeing the spine remains aligned. For side sleepers, testing the mattress's ability to cushion the shoulders and hips is essential. Stomach sleepers need to verify their hips do not sink excessively, which can cause misalignment. By thoroughly testing these positions, potential buyers can make informed decisions that meet their unique sleeping styles and preferences.
Analyze Edge Support
Edge support is a essential element to consider when assessing a mattress, as it impacts overall stability and usability. A mattress with dependable edge support enables sleepers to utilize the entire surface, making it more convenient to get in and out of bed. To assess edge support, testers should sit on the edge of the mattress and see how it responds. If the mattress feels stable and doesn't sag considerably, it indicates good edge support. Additionally, lying near the edge can help determine comfort levels and prevent feelings of rolling off. Testers should also think about how the mattress performs during various activities, such as sitting or leaning, to guarantee it meets their needs for support and durability.
